RUNBOOK — Quillbus log compaction. Compaction runs hourly on each broker and trims segments older than the retention window. If disk usage climbs past 80%, verify compaction threads are alive before adding capacity; a stuck thread is the usual culprit on the Verano cluster. Before restarting the compactor, record the broker's active configuration, shown here.

deployment values, bajop-yahaf:
[holax]
host = holax.tolvaqsys.corp
user = holax_svc
database = holax_prod

14:22 — DepAtlas render workers began timing out on graphs over 10k nodes. 14:31 — traced to the cycle-detection pass introduced in the morning deploy; it re-walks the full graph per edge. 14:40 — rolled the Oxbridle cluster back to the prior image; timeouts cleared within four minutes. 14:55 — confirmed no data loss; cached layouts regenerated cleanly. Follow-up: add a node-count gate before cycle detection. The rolled-back image is identified by the token below.

build token for kagaf-hahof: htk14_9d3d4d26d7d8de

Heads up: overnight builds of the AgriLink telemetry gateway started failing signature verification on the Fennmoor staging fleet around 02:40. Looks like the packaging job picked up the retired key after last week's rotation, so every tractor-side agent is rejecting the update and falling back to v1.8. Rollback is holding fine, no data loss. To re-sign and repush, use the current gateway deploy key, pasted below for convenience.

release key, kawif-hawep: bky13_X7TGuRG4Zu4ZJ

v2.4.1 — Glyphcart font vendoring. Renamed FONT_MIRROR_URL to VENDOR_FONT_SOURCE; the old key is deprecated and logs a warning until v2.6. Vendored fonts now pin checksums at build time, so cache busts no longer refetch the whole set. Action for everyone before Friday's sync: update local env files. The mirror's access token belongs on the line immediately after this note.

vault entry, yahaf-tagug: LEDGER_TOKEN20=884d77d1a8b98aa4edfb